The Legal Battle Surrounding Satoshi Nakamoto: An Examination of the Current Situation

Satoshi Nakamoto, the mysterious creator of Bitcoin, has been a subject of fascination and speculation since the inception of the world’s first cryptocurrency. While Nakamoto’s true identity remains unknown, the legal battle surrounding him has taken center stage in recent years. This article aims to provide an examination of the current situation surrounding the legal battles involving Satoshi Nakamoto.

One of the key legal battles surrounding Nakamoto revolves around his intellectual property rights. As the creator of Bitcoin, Nakamoto holds significant control over the technology and its underlying code. This has led to numerous lawsuits and disputes over ownership and copyright infringement. Many individuals and companies have claimed to be the true Satoshi Nakamoto, seeking to gain control over Bitcoin’s intellectual property rights.

In 2018, Craig Wright, an Australian computer scientist, made headlines by claiming to be Satoshi Nakamoto. Wright’s claim was met with skepticism and criticism from the cryptocurrency community. Several legal battles ensued, with Wright facing lawsuits from individuals who disputed his claim and sought to prove their own identities as Nakamoto.

One notable lawsuit involved Wright’s attempt to sue Bitcoin.org for hosting the Bitcoin whitepaper, claiming copyright infringement. The case was eventually dismissed by a UK court, highlighting the challenges faced by individuals claiming ownership over Nakamoto’s work.

Another legal battle surrounding Nakamoto involves the ongoing dispute between Wright and the estate of Dave Kleiman, a computer scientist who was involved in the early development of Bitcoin. Following Kleiman’s death in 2013, Wright claimed that he and Kleiman had jointly created Bitcoin. Kleiman’s estate filed a lawsuit against Wright, alleging that he had fraudulently acquired a significant amount of Bitcoin and intellectual property belonging to Kleiman.

The case has seen numerous twists and turns, with both parties presenting evidence and witnesses to support their claims. The court has yet to reach a final verdict, leaving the legal battle surrounding Nakamoto’s identity and the ownership of Bitcoin’s intellectual property rights unresolved.

The legal battles surrounding Nakamoto have far-reaching implications for the cryptocurrency industry as a whole. The outcome of these cases could determine who has control over Bitcoin’s development and future direction. It also raises questions about the decentralized nature of cryptocurrencies and the potential for centralized control by individuals claiming to be Nakamoto.

Furthermore, these legal battles highlight the need for clarity and regulation in the cryptocurrency space. The lack of clear guidelines and legal frameworks surrounding cryptocurrencies has allowed for disputes and lawsuits to arise. Governments and regulatory bodies around the world are grappling with how to address these issues and provide a stable legal environment for the industry to thrive.

In conclusion, the legal battle surrounding Satoshi Nakamoto continues to unfold, with multiple lawsuits and disputes over ownership and intellectual property rights. The outcome of these cases will have significant implications for the cryptocurrency industry and its future development. As the legal battles continue, it is crucial for regulators and industry participants to work towards establishing clear guidelines and regulations to ensure a stable and secure environment for cryptocurrencies to flourish.
